【2024年】Excel VBAのおすすめ本”12選”

Excel VBA(Visual Basic for Applications)は、Microsoft Excelのマクロ機能を利用して、プログラムによる自動化やカスタマイズを行うためのプログラミング言語です。ユーザーが繰り返し行う作業を自動化し、複雑なデータ処理やレポート作成を効率化することができます。VBAを使うことで、Excelの機能を拡張し、効率的なデータ管理が可能になります。

Excel VBAを学ぶメリットは、業務の効率化と自動化が可能になる点です。繰り返しのデータ入力や処理、複雑な計算を自動化し、エラーを減らして時間を節約できます。カスタム関数やユーザーフォームを作成することで、Excelの機能を大幅に拡張でき、データ分析やレポート作成のプロセスを大幅に効率化します。業務の生産性向上や、データ管理の精度を高めるための強力なツールとして役立ちます。

スポンサーリンク

Excel VBAのプログラミングのツボとコツがゼッタイにわかる本[第2版]

ExcelVBA[完全]入門

増強改訂版 できる イラストで学ぶ 入社1年目からのExcel VBA

今すぐ使えるかんたんbiz Excelマクロ&VBA 効率UPスキル大全

よくわかる Excel マクロ/VBA Office 2021/2019/2016/Microsoft 365対応

Excel VBA塾【動画✕本で学ぶ! 】 ~初心者OK! 仕事をマクロで自動化する12のレッスン

Excel VBA 逆引き大全 600の極意 Microsoft 365/Office 2021/2019/2016/2013対応

Excel VBA開発を超効率化するプログラミングテクニック ームダな作業をゼロにする開発のコツー

Excel VBA でちゃんとしたアプリを作る本

ExcelVBAを実務で使い倒す技術

VBAエキスパート公式テキスト Excel VBAベーシック

パーフェクトExcel VBA (PERFECT SERIES)

まとめ

Excel VBAの本は人生に役立ちます。Excel VBA(Visual Basic for Applications)は、Microsoft Excelの強力な機能を活用し、データ管理や業務プロセスを自動化するためのプログラミング言語です。VBAを学ぶことで、業務の効率化と生産性向上を実現できるだけでなく、データ処理やレポート作成のスキルを大幅に強化できます。

まず、VBAを習得することで、日々の反復作業を自動化し、時間を大幅に節約できます。例えば、データの入力や整形、複雑な計算を自動化するマクロを作成することで、手作業によるエラーを減らし、作業の正確性を向上させることができます。これにより、単調な作業から解放され、より戦略的な業務やクリエイティブなタスクに集中することが可能になります。

また、VBAの学習は、データ分析やレポート作成の効率を劇的に改善します。例えば、定期的に更新するレポートやダッシュボードを自動生成することで、情報の可視化や分析が迅速かつ正確に行えます。これにより、ビジネスの意思決定に必要な情報を迅速に提供でき、データ駆動型の意思決定が可能になります。特に大規模なデータセットを扱う場合、VBAのスキルが役立ちます。

VBAを学ぶことで、カスタム関数やユーザーフォームを作成し、Excelの機能を拡張することができます。例えば、特定の業務ニーズに合わせたカスタムツールやアプリケーションを開発し、チームや組織の特定の要件に応じたソリューションを提供することができます。これにより、業務プロセスの最適化や業務効率の向上が図れます。

さらに、VBAの知識はキャリアにおいても大いに役立ちます。多くの企業がExcelを業務で使用しており、VBAスキルを持つことで、データ管理や業務プロセスの改善を提案できる能力が評価されます。業務の自動化や効率化を図ることで、昇進や転職の際に有利となるでしょう。また、VBAスキルを持つことで、プロジェクト管理や業務分析の役割にも対応でき、職場での価値を高めることができます。

Excel VBAを学ぶことは、業務の効率化、データ分析の精度向上、カスタムツールの開発、そしてキャリアの成長において非常に有益です。VBAの知識を持つことで、日々の業務をスムーズにこなすだけでなく、より戦略的で価値の高い業務を実現するための強力なツールを手に入れることができます。このように、Excel VBAのスキルは、業務の生産性を向上させるだけでなく、キャリアの発展にも寄与します。